Role Description The Sales Attendant role at Bajaj Finserv Loans is a full-time, on-site position based in Madhubani.

The Sales

Attendant will engage with walk-in and referred customers, understand their financial needs, and provide information on suitable loan products such as personal, business, travel, and education loans.

Responsibilities include explaining product features and eligibility criteria, assisting customers with documentation, and guiding them through the application process. The role involves maintaining accurate records of customer interactions, following up on leads, and supporting the completion of disbursals.

The Sales

Attendant will also collaborate with internal teams to resolve customer queries, ensure compliance with company policies, and help meet branch sales targets while delivering professional and respectful customer service.
